我實際上只是在學習 LaTeX,在繞了一小時之後,我認為直接問會更容易。
我正在嘗試按如下方式格式化報告:
1. First Section 1.1 Subsection Title 1.1.1 This is paragraph one 1.1.2 This is paragraph two
2. Second Section 2.1 Subsection Title 2.1.1 This is paragraph three 2.1.2 This is paragraph four
理想情況下,我想定義一個簡單的「標籤」(很抱歉,我不知道正確的術語),以便它看起來如下:
\documentclass{article}
\title{My Document Title}
\begin{document}
\section{First Section}
\subsection{Subsection Title}
\mycustomtag This is paragraph one
\mycustomtag This is paragraph two
\section{Second Section}
\subsection{Subsection Title}
\mycustomtag This is paragraph three
\mycustomtag This is paragraph four
\end{document}
這可能嗎? (理想情況下,章節和小節仍然可以在目錄中使用?)。我找到了對段落進行編號的方法,但因為我沒有使用小節,所以數字變成了 1.1.0.1 等,我寧願避免。
任何幫助將不勝感激。
答案1
如果您希望子小節像段落一樣運作,則需要變更其定義中的值。原始定義在article.cls:
\documentclass{article}
\makeatletter
\renewcommand\subsubsection{\@startsection{subsubsection}{3}{\z@}%
{-3.25ex\@plus -1ex \@minus -.2ex}%
{-1em}% <---changed
{\normalfont\normalsize\bfseries}}
\makeatother
\begin{document}
\section{blub}
\subsection{bblb} blblb
\subsubsection{blbl}blblb
\paragraph{blbl} bblbl
\end{document}
您也可以使用該titlesec
套件。或者您可以使用類別scrartcl
(KOMA 捆綁包的一部分)而不是article
,KOMA 有自己的系統來適應標題命令。